Output 86453e27a7685b376c24f24b1d5fa523bb76daa8591e1d8168b8a0c5bacb7de2:0

value
691882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3e0f39a24711f3aa3af3ea83b03078ffce000bb OP_EQUAL
address
3KYjArpjZL6uQL3kLrDDctg3J81ms2GN3m
transaction
86453e27a7685b376c24f24b1d5fa523bb76daa8591e1d8168b8a0c5bacb7de2
spent
true